Camembert cheese calories and nutrition facts

100 grams of camembert cheese contains 297 calories, with 19.8 g of protein, 0.5 g of carbohydrate and 24.3 g of fat. Most of its calories come from fat.

Where the calories come from

Protein 26% Carbs 1% Fat 73%

Is camembert cheese low in carbs?

Yes by the numbers: Camembert cheese has 0.5 g of carbohydrate per 100 g. People following low-carb or keto approaches often include foods in this range — portion size and your own plan still decide.
